Conserved phenotype and function of human brain border-associated macrophages in iPSC-derived models
2025-12-14
Abstract excerpt
<h4>SUMMARY</h4> Border-associated macrophages (BAMs) are increasingly implicated in protective brain functions including the removal of pathogenic material such as amyloid-beta (Aβ). However, there is a lack of available and deeply characterized human BAM models.
